Job Purpose:

The overall responsibilities of this position are vital within Group Credit Risk team covering areas relating to PW & BB Portfolio including Group level provisioning under IFRS 9, Credit Risk Reporting, analysis and regulatory aspects such as Asset Quality, Impairment, provision adequacy & coverage, and credit portfolio monitoring & reporting. The role holder s primary responsibilities include:

  • Undertake IFRS 9 staging and Provisioning review process as per Regulatory requirement and internal policy including international locations.
  • Assist in reviewing inputs & variables used in the development of various Models. (Rating Models, IFRS9 related PD & LGD Models etc .
  • Assist in analysis of Assets Quality, Impairment Charge, Coverage and COR by business segment for PW & BB Portfolio across FAB Group
  • Assist in submission of detailed monthly dashboards and analysis reports
  • Maintain Risk data base (PW & BB) for robust monitoring and Reporting of Credit Risk
  • Asist in portfolio stress analysis related to PW & BB Portfolio.
  • Work on specialized Project, budgets and forecast related to PW & BB Portfolio

Job Context:

Specific Accountability

PW & BB - Credit Risk:

  • Assist in reviewing input data and coordinate with other stakeholders like PW & BB Credit, ERS team in development, rollout and maintenance of various models and scorecards etc
  • Assist in Carry out thematic portfolio stress testing/scenario analysis by providing relevant data set.
  • Support in annual budgeting and forecasting exercise of PW & BB portfolio.

IFRS 9 Execution and Reporting:

  • Undertake IFRS 9 staging and ECL review process adherence to IFRS/local regulatory requirements/ internal policies and provide flash report to line manager
  • Coordinate with overseas Risk team to conclude IFRS 9 run
  • Maintain and follow-up on approval of the staging and ECL overrides as required under IFRS9 Imperilment policy.
  • Provide support for the annual review and update of IFRS9 Impairment policy.
  • Assist in identification of optimization opportunities within the portfolio through data correction and other initiatives.
  • Follow up and provide support to close any pending points related IFRS 9 review to Steering Committee
  • Oversight on monthly basis input data submission from Credit Department for IFRS 9 such as NPL, IIS and ECL to ensure that ECL Provision accurately reflect Group risk profile.
  • Assist in preparation of IFRS9 related MIS / data/reports to be submitted internally and to regulatory authorities.

Early warning, thematic review, Credit Risk Appetite

  • Provide support to carry out thematic review / Stress testing as required by Management by Providing required data set.
  • Prepare Tier 2.5 demographics for risk appetite reporting & monitoring for PW & BB

Portfolio Management & Regulatory reporting: PW & BB /FAB

  • Preparation of reports to monitor credit quality of the portfolio across PW & BB Portfolio.
  • Assist in the development and maintenance of credit risk data base to ensure timely availability of data for analysis, forecasting and decision making.
  • Assist the development of dashboards for the managed portfolio.
  • Prepare Industry-wise exposure, ECL and collateral coverage for Credit Risk deck, Investor Relations, Rating Agencies, etc.
  • Prepare Stage3 reporting and reconciliation on a monthly basis in coordination with Finance
  • Prepare Tier 2.5 demographics for risk appetite reporting & monitoring for Consumer Banking
  • Prepare reports for various Rating Agencies for further submission to Investor Relations
  • Prepare Credit Risk related Pillar 3 disclosures for Industry and Geography breakdown
  • Provide relevant risk information and analysis to support discussions with credit rating agencies / External Auditor /Central Bank etc
  • Engage with IT and other relevant departments to streamline processes and improve efficiency across the bank.
  • Provide support and data sets as required by Internal/ External/ CBUAE Auditor in their respective reviews.

RCSA , BCM, KRI and Operation Risk Management :

  • Prepare BIA and BCP for Credit Risk in coordination with Business Continuity Management
  • Prepare RCSA in coordination with Group Operational Risk Management.Qualifications
